책 리뷰, 컴퓨터/IT

『단위 테스트의 기술』, 컴퓨터/IT 분야 98위, 꼭 봐야할 책 추천 가이드

안녕하세요! 오늘은 개발자들에게 꼭 필요한 책 추천 한 권 들고 왔습니다 ^^ 요즘 단위 테스트가 얼마나 중요한지 다들 느끼고 계시죠? 저도 업무 중 갑자기 『단위 테스트의 기술』 책에 푹 빠져서 퇴근 후 내내 머릿속이 테스트 코드 생각뿐이었답니다. 처음엔 어렵게만 생각했던 단위 테스트, 이 책 한 권으로 기본기도 다지고 실무에 바로 써먹을 수 있는 방법까지 자세히 배우게 되니, 책 추천 리스트에 바로 올렸답니다.



이 책이 마음에 든다면 할인된 가격으로 바로 구매하세요!




단위 테스트의 기술

로이 오셔로브 외

기본 개념과 실전 예제, 리팩터링, 유지 보수성 향상, 조직 내 테스트 도입까지
한 권으로 끝내는 단위 테스트 완벽 가이드

『단위 테스트의 기술』, 컴퓨터/IT 분야 98위, 꼭 봐야할 책 추천 가이드

목차



  • 1부 시작하기
  • 1장 단위 테스트의 기초
  • 1.1 누구에게나 처음은 있다
  • 1.2 단위 테스트 정의
  • 1.3 진입점과 종료점
  • 1.4 종료점 유형
  • 1.5 다른 종료점, 다른 기법


사실 단위 테스트는 제가 그동안 좀 귀찮게 여기기도 했어요. 코드 작성할 때까지는 몰랐던 불필요한 오류들 때문에 나중에 수정하고 버그 찾아내는 데 들이는 시간이 만만치 않다는 걸 알면서도 말입니다. 그런데 『단위 테스트의 기술』을 읽으면서 생각이 완전히 바뀌었어요. 이 책은 단순히 테스트를 어떻게 하라가 아니라 왜 해야 하는지, 그리고 최신 테스트 프레임워크인 제스트까지 이용하는 방법을 알려줘서 실제 코드에 쉽게 적용할 수 있었죠. 특히 고급 기법인 목이나 스텁 같은 개념도 의존성 문제에서 얼마나 중요한지 상세히 다루는데, 그 부분은 실무에 꼭 필요한 감이랄까. 개인적으로는 코드를 리팩터링할 때 자신감이 붙었고, 유지보수성이 훨씬 좋아지는 경험을 했답니다. 그리고 저처럼 테스트 도입에 주저하는 조직에서도 어떻게 변화를 이끌어야 하는지 구체적인 전략까지 있어서 감탄했네요. 덕분에 개발 현장에서의 스트레스가 줄고, 자신감 있는 코딩이 가능해졌답니다. 여러 번 꾸준히 읽으면서 점점 더 좋은 테스트 코드를 짤 수 있는 노하우를 쌓을 수 있을 것 같아요. 요즘 같은 IT 시대에는 이 책 추천 안 하면 후회할 정도입니다.



저자 ‘로이 오셔로브 외’에 대하여

로이 오셔로브는 초기 ALT.NET 커뮤니티를 이끌었던 멤버 중 한 명으로, 이전에는 Typemock에서 수석 아키텍트로 근무했다. 그는 전 세계를 누비며 단위 테스트와 TDD에 대해 컨설팅하고 교육하며, 5whys.com을 통해 팀의 리더가 더 나은 리더십을 발휘할 수 있도록 교육하고 있다. X에서는 @RoyOsherove로 활동하고 있으며, ArtOfUnitTesting.com에서는 단위 테스트와 관련한 다양한 영상을 제공하고 있다. 강연 및 교육은 Osherove.com에서 신청할 수 있다.


단위 테스트에 관심 있었던 분이라면 『단위 테스트의 기술』은 정말 필독서예요! 처음 시작하는 사람부터 팀 내 테스트 문화를 바꾸고 싶은 분들까지 누구에게나 큰 도움을 줄 책 추천이니까요. 저처럼 책을 읽고 바로 실무에 적용하니 훨씬 안정적인 코드와 더 나은 설계가 이뤄져서 정말 만족도가 높습니다. 앞으로도 계속 읽으면서 실력을 쌓아갈 예정입니다. 컴퓨터/IT 분야에서 98위까지 올라갈 만한 이유가 뭔지 직접 경험해보세요. 이 책 추천 강력 추천합니다! 꼭 한 번 읽어보시길!




이 책이 마음에 든다면 할인된 가격으로 바로 구매하세요!

📚 다른 책도 둘러보세요